| - // Gives the browser a chance to handle an accelerator that was
|
| - // sent to the out of proc chromium instance.
|
| - // Returns S_OK iff the accelerator was handled by the browser.
|
| - HRESULT AllowFrameToTranslateAccelerator(const MSG& msg) {
|
| - static const int kMayTranslateAcceleratorOffset = 0x5c;
|
| - // Although IBrowserService2 is officially deprecated, it's still alive
|
| - // and well in IE7 and earlier. We have to use it here to correctly give
|
| - // the browser a chance to handle keyboard shortcuts.
|
| - // This happens automatically for activex components that have windows that
|
| - // belong to the current thread. In that circumstance IE owns the message
|
| - // loop and can walk the line of components allowing each participant the
|
| - // chance to handle the keystroke and eventually falls back to
|
| - // v_MayTranslateAccelerator. However in our case, the message loop is
|
| - // owned by the out-of-proc chromium instance so IE doesn't have a chance to
|
| - // fall back on its default behavior. Instead we give IE a chance to
|
| - // handle the shortcut here.
|
| - MSG accel_message = msg;
|
| - accel_message.hwnd = ::GetParent(m_hWnd);
|
| - HRESULT hr = S_FALSE;
|
| - base::win::ScopedComPtr<IBrowserService2> bs2;
|
| -
|
| - // For non-IE containers, we use the standard IOleInPlaceFrame contract
|
| - // (which IE does not support). For IE, we try to use IBrowserService2,
|
| - // but need special handling for IE8 (see below).
|
| - //
|
| - // We try to cache an IOleInPlaceFrame for our site. If we fail, we don't
|
| - // retry, and we fall back to the IBrowserService2 and PostMessage
|
| - // approaches below.
|
| - if (!in_place_frame_ && !failed_to_fetch_in_place_frame_) {
|
| - base::win::ScopedComPtr<IOleInPlaceUIWindow> dummy_ui_window;
|
| - RECT dummy_pos_rect = {0};
|
| - RECT dummy_clip_rect = {0};
|
| - OLEINPLACEFRAMEINFO dummy_frame_info = {0};
|
| - if (!m_spInPlaceSite ||
|
| - FAILED(m_spInPlaceSite->GetWindowContext(in_place_frame_.Receive(),
|
| - dummy_ui_window.Receive(),
|
| - &dummy_pos_rect,
|
| - &dummy_clip_rect,
|
| - &dummy_frame_info))) {
|
| - failed_to_fetch_in_place_frame_ = true;
|
| - }
|
| - }
|
| -
|
| - // The IBrowserService2 code below (second conditional) explicitly checks
|
| - // for whether the IBrowserService2::v_MayTranslateAccelerator function is
|
| - // valid. On IE8 there is one vtable ieframe!c_ImpostorBrowserService2Vtbl
|
| - // where this function entry is NULL which leads to a crash. We don't know
|
| - // under what circumstances this vtable is actually used though.
|
| - if (in_place_frame_) {
|
| - hr = in_place_frame_->TranslateAccelerator(&accel_message, 0);
|
| - } else if (S_OK == DoQueryService(
|
| - SID_STopLevelBrowser, m_spInPlaceSite,
|
| - bs2.Receive()) && bs2.get() &&
|
| - *(*(reinterpret_cast<void***>(bs2.get())) +
|
| - kMayTranslateAcceleratorOffset)) {
|
| - hr = bs2->v_MayTranslateAccelerator(&accel_message);
|
| - } else {
|
| - // IE8 doesn't support IBrowserService2 unless you enable a special,
|
| - // undocumented flag with CoInternetSetFeatureEnabled and even then,
|
| - // the object you get back implements only a couple of methods of
|
| - // that interface... all the other entries in the vtable are NULL.
|
| - // In addition, the class that implements it is called
|
| - // ImpostorBrowserService2 :)
|
| - // IE8 does have a new interface though, presumably called
|
| - // ITabBrowserService or something that can be abbreviated to TBS.
|
| - // That interface has a method, TranslateAcceleratorTBS that does
|
| - // call the root MayTranslateAccelerator function, but alas the
|
| - // first argument to MayTranslateAccelerator is hard coded to FALSE
|
| - // which means that global accelerators are not handled and we're
|
| - // out of luck.
|
| - // A third thing that's notable with regards to IE8 is that
|
| - // none of the *MayTranslate* functions exist in a vtable inside
|
| - // ieframe.dll. I checked this by scanning for the address of
|
| - // those functions inside the dll and found none, which means that
|
| - // all calls to those functions are relative.
|
| - // So, for IE8 in certain cases, and for other containers that may
|
| - // support neither IOleInPlaceFrame or IBrowserService2 our approach
|
| - // is very simple. Just post the message to our parent window and IE
|
| - // will pick it up if it's an accelerator. We won't know for sure if
|
| - // the browser handled the keystroke or not.
|
| - ::PostMessage(accel_message.hwnd, accel_message.message,
|
| - accel_message.wParam, accel_message.lParam);
|
| - }
|
| -
|
| - return hr;
|
| - }
